A spinal and bulbar muscular atrophy (SBMA) disease-specific human embryonic stem cell (hESC) line, UMICHe002-A/UM197-1
Spinal and Bulbar Muscular Atrophy (SBMA) is an X-linked degenerative disorder of the neuromuscular system that is caused by an expanded CAG/polyglutamine (polyQ) tract within the Androgen Receptor (AR) gene.
